Job Title: Abrasive Blaster/Painter/Quality Control/Supervision

Location: Various locations throughout

Alberta & British Columbia, including Fort McMurray, Edmonton (surrounding area) Vancouver, Prince Rupert and Squamish

Anticipated Start Date: August 1, 2026, and ongoing

Job Type: Seasonal with opportunities for full-time employment

Schedule: Various rotational and standard schedules, averaging

40-60 hours per week, depending on project requirements

Salary: $24.56-$49.11 per hour

Note: Quality Control/ Supervision roles are subject to higher rates based on experience, certifications, and applicable qualifications

What You’ll Do

■ Shutdowns/Turnarounds

■ Facility maintenance

■ Abrasive blasting

■ Brush & rolling paint

■ Confined space access

■ Spray painting (airless and plural)

■ Manual lifting

■ Working at heights

■ Note* Quality Control and Leadership positions require a different set of qualifications and competencies

What You Need to Have

■ Construction & labour experience *Willing to hire and develop entry level workers to support project staffing requirements

■ Industrial/commercial painting experience

■ Safety training such as Energy Safety Canada H2S, Confined Space, Fall Protection an asset

What We Offer

■ Local 177 Union Benefits

■ 10% Vacation Pay

■ Double Time on Weekends & Stat Holidays (Dependent on project specific agreements)

■ Camp Accommodation (Live out allowance on applicable projects)

■ Travel Allowance Applicable (Dependent on project specific agreements)

■ Competitive Wages

■ Advancement Opportunities

■ Hands-on Training/Learning
